Output eab153f75833447bce85fca12971eb883995f9156ebd9d63abc1af69c99c3a2d:1

value
510955
script pubkey
OP_0 OP_PUSHBYTES_20 d9c2704f5418445673cef4fb70b8694087d76868
address
bc1qm8p8qn65rpz9vu7w7nahpwrfgzraw6rg40dfd8
transaction
eab153f75833447bce85fca12971eb883995f9156ebd9d63abc1af69c99c3a2d
confirmations
55604
spent
true